| /** |
| * Connects two Git repositories together and copies objects between them. |
| * <p> |
| * A transport can be used for either fetching (copying objects into the |
| * caller's repository from the remote repository) or pushing (copying objects |
| * into the remote repository from the caller's repository). Each transport |
| * implementation is responsible for the details associated with establishing |
| * the network connection(s) necessary for the copy, as well as actually |
| * shuffling data back and forth. |
| * <p> |
| * Transport instances and the connections they create are not thread-safe. |
| * Callers must ensure a transport is accessed by only one thread at a time. |
| */ |
| public abstract class Transport implements AutoCloseable { |
| /** Type of operation a Transport is being opened for. */ |
| public enum Operation { |
| /** Transport is to fetch objects locally. */ |
| FETCH, |
| /** Transport is to push objects remotely. */ |
| PUSH; |
| } |

| /** |
| * Register a TransportProtocol instance for use during open. |
| * <p> |
| * Protocol definitions are held by WeakReference, allowing them to be |
| * garbage collected when the calling application drops all strongly held |
| * references to the TransportProtocol. Therefore applications should use a |
| * singleton pattern as described in |
| * {@link org.eclipse.jgit.transport.TransportProtocol}'s class |
| * documentation to ensure their protocol does not get disabled by garbage |
| * collection earlier than expected. |
| * <p> |
| * The new protocol is registered in front of all earlier protocols, giving |
| * it higher priority than the built-in protocol definitions. |
| * |
| * @param proto |
| * the protocol definition. Must not be null. |
| */ |
| public static void register(TransportProtocol proto) { |
| protocols.add(0, new WeakReference<>(proto)); |
| } |

| /** |
| * How {@link #fetch(ProgressMonitor, Collection)} should handle tags. |
| * <p> |
| * We default to {@link TagOpt#NO_TAGS} so as to avoid fetching annotated |
| * tags during one-shot fetches used for later merges. This prevents |
| * dragging down tags from repositories that we do not have established |
| * tracking branches for. If we do not track the source repository, we most |
| * likely do not care about any tags it publishes. |
| */ |
| private TagOpt tagopt = TagOpt.NO_TAGS; |
